  • 400g lamb loin
    any fat or sinew removed
  • 2 cloves garlic
    crushed
  • 100g panca chilli paste or any smoked chilli paste
  • 2 tsp red wine vinegar
  • 1 tbsp soy sauce
  • achiote (annatto seeds) oil or rapeseed oil
  • olive oil
    for frying
  • 240g Olluco potatoes, Anya potatoes or new potatoes
    boiled and halved to serve
  • Greek yoghurt
    to serve

PERUVIAN HERB MIX

  • a bunch coriander
    chopped
  • a bunch basil
    chopped
  • a bunch tarragon
    chopped

UCHUCUTA SAUCE

  • 50g garlic cloves
    (approx. 1 bulb)
  • a large bunch coriander
  • 200g baby spinach
  • 15g cancha corn or shelled pistachios
  • 20g feta
  • 100-150ml olive oil

MACA-CANCHA-PANCA powder

  • 5g maca powder
  • 10g cancha corn or shelled pistachios
    blended to a powder
  • 10g aji panca chilli powder or other smoked chilli powder

Method

  • step 1

    Put all of the herbs in a blender and whizz until finely chopped. Mix the garlic, panca chilli paste, vinegar, soy sauce, achiote oil and Peruvian herb mix in a large bowl.

  • step 2

    Portion the lamb equally into 4. Add the lamb, stir to coat in the spices and marinate for 3 hours. Remove from the fridge half an hour before cooking to come to room temperature.

Cook's note: Maca powder is available from health food shops.
